一、引言
隨著企業(yè)規(guī)模的擴大和業(yè)務的日益復雜,多租戶集團架構已成為企業(yè)信息化建設的核心組成部分。這種架構允許在一個統(tǒng)一的平臺上為多個租戶提供獨立的業(yè)務環(huán)境,既保證了數(shù)據(jù)的隔離性,又提高了系統(tǒng)的資源利用率。本文將深入探討多租戶集團架構的設計原則、關鍵技術、實施步驟以及面臨的挑戰(zhàn),并對未來的發(fā)展趨勢進行展望。
二、多租戶集團架構的設計原則
1. 數(shù)據(jù)隔離性:確保每個租戶的數(shù)據(jù)相互獨立,防止數(shù)據(jù)泄露和非法訪問。
2. 性能優(yōu)化:設計高效的系統(tǒng)架構,以支持多個租戶的業(yè)務需求,并保證系統(tǒng)性能的穩(wěn)定。
3. 安全可靠性:采用多層次的安全措施,確保系統(tǒng)的穩(wěn)定運行和租戶數(shù)據(jù)的安全。
4. 易用性和可維護性:提供簡潔易用的界面和功能,降低用戶的學習成本,同時保證系統(tǒng)的可維護性,減少運維成本。
5. 靈活性和可擴展性:設計靈活的架構,以適應租戶業(yè)務的快速變化和發(fā)展,同時保證系統(tǒng)的可擴展性。
三、多租戶集團架構的關鍵技術
1. 數(shù)據(jù)庫技術:為實現(xiàn)數(shù)據(jù)隔離,常采用獨立數(shù)據(jù)庫、共享數(shù)據(jù)庫獨立模式或共享數(shù)據(jù)庫共享模式。
2. 云服務技術:利用云計算的彈性擴展能力,快速部署和配置多租戶系統(tǒng),提高系統(tǒng)的可用性和穩(wěn)定性。
3. 權限管理技術:通過角色訪問控制(RBAC)等技術,實現(xiàn)租戶間權限的細粒度控制。
4. 緩存技術:采用Redis等緩存系統(tǒng),提高多租戶系統(tǒng)的響應速度和并發(fā)處理能力。
5. 容器化技術:使用Docker等容器化技術,實現(xiàn)多租戶系統(tǒng)的快速部署和隔離。
四、多租戶集團架構的實施步驟
1. 需求分析:明確多租戶系統(tǒng)的業(yè)務需求,包括租戶數(shù)量、業(yè)務規(guī)模、并發(fā)訪問量等。
2. 架構設計:根據(jù)需求分析結果,設計多租戶系統(tǒng)的整體架構,包括數(shù)據(jù)庫設計、云服務配置、權限管理策略等。
3. 系統(tǒng)開發(fā):依據(jù)架構設計,進行系統(tǒng)的開發(fā)工作,包括前端界面開發(fā)、后端業(yè)務邏輯實現(xiàn)、數(shù)據(jù)庫訪問層開發(fā)等。
4. 系統(tǒng)測試:在系統(tǒng)開發(fā)完成后,進行全面的系統(tǒng)測試,確保系統(tǒng)功能的正確性和穩(wěn)定性。
5. 部署上線:將系統(tǒng)部署到生產(chǎn)環(huán)境,并進行上線前的最后檢查和準備。
6. 運維監(jiān)控:上線后,進行持續(xù)的運維監(jiān)控,確保系統(tǒng)的正常運行和數(shù)據(jù)的安全可靠。
五、多租戶集團架構面臨的挑戰(zhàn)
1. 數(shù)據(jù)隔離與性能平衡:如何在保證數(shù)據(jù)隔離的同時,實現(xiàn)系統(tǒng)性能的最優(yōu)化。
2. 安全與隱私保護:確保租戶數(shù)據(jù)的安全性和隱私性,防止數(shù)據(jù)泄露和非法訪問。
3. 個性化需求滿足:滿足不同租戶的個性化業(yè)務需求,同時保持系統(tǒng)的穩(wěn)定性和可維護性。
4. 運維和管理:隨著租戶數(shù)量的增加和系統(tǒng)規(guī)模的擴大,如何提高運維效率和管理水平。
六、多租戶集團架構的未來發(fā)展
1. 智能化運維管理:引入人工智能和機器學習技術,實現(xiàn)多租戶系統(tǒng)的自動化運維和智能管理,降低運維成本,提高管理效率。
2. 自適應調(diào)整與彈性伸縮:利用云計算的彈性伸縮能力,實現(xiàn)多租戶系統(tǒng)的動態(tài)資源分配和自適應調(diào)整,滿足租戶不斷變化的業(yè)務需求。
3. 安全與隱私保護增強:進一步加強數(shù)據(jù)安全措施和隱私保護機制,采用先進的加密技術和訪問控制策略,確保租戶數(shù)據(jù)的安全性和隱私性。
4. 跨平臺與跨云部署:實現(xiàn)多租戶系統(tǒng)的跨平臺和跨云部署,提高系統(tǒng)的靈活性和可擴展性,滿足企業(yè)不斷增長的業(yè)務需求。
七、結論
多租戶集團架構作為一種高效、靈活的企業(yè)信息化解決方案,正逐漸成為企業(yè)信息化建設的主流趨勢。通過合理的設計和實施步驟,結合先進的技術和持續(xù)的創(chuàng)新發(fā)展,多租戶集團架構將為企業(yè)提供更加安全、可靠、高效的信息化服務,推動企業(yè)業(yè)務的快速發(fā)展和持續(xù)增長。
數(shù)商云業(yè)務協(xié)同與智能化電商解決方案, 實現(xiàn)供應鏈上中下游資源整合管理
--------
SCM系統(tǒng) / SRM系統(tǒng)/ 采購商城系統(tǒng) / DMS渠道商 / 經(jīng)銷商管理 / 訂貨平臺
B2B / S2B2B / S2B2C / B2B2B / B2B2C /B2C/ 多租戶 / 跨境電商
評論